The beginning chapters were slow but the pacing was good after that. I enjoyed the suspense of the novel and liked this take on AI. An interesting multilayered plot with well developed characters was enhanced by a full cast audiobook. I enjoyed it but it was dark and some of the back stories were tough. I'd reccommend checking the content warnings.
